I bought the 15-inch for a Canon 70-300mm zoom and the 11-inch for a Canon 20mm f/2.8 prime. Both fit perfectly. To size them, know this. The 11-inch is 11" wide on all four sides, so it is 15.5" diagonally (high school math and the Pythagorean theorem for the win). Look up your lens, take the maximum width and double it, take the length and double it, then add the two up. It should be a little less than the diagonal measurement so you have some overlap for the velcro to grab on.
I bought two of these for a trip, so I could take a couple lenses but not the whole gear bag. They worked very well, but you'll still have to pack them properly. I wouldn't just toss them in anywhere. On the plane, I had them wrapped up inside a jacket in my backpack. Walking around, they were snug inside a shoulder bag with a few other things. I wouldn't just roll them around loose in a big backpack, as the padding is not super thick. I see some folks have used this for wrapping a SLR body with lens attached, but I don't see how.
